lyft Lyft Cuts 13% of Workforce as Ride-Hailing Demand Slows Lyft is laying off approximately 683 employees, or about 13% of its staff, in an effort to reduce costs amid economic uncertainty and a slowdown in the ride-hailing market. The company's leadership admits to hiring too aggressively during the pandemic boom.
stripe Stripe Cuts 14% of Staff as CEO Admits Overhiring Mistakes Fintech giant Stripe lays off over 1,100 employees, citing over-optimism about internet economy growth and rapidly rising operating costs. CEO Patrick Collison takes full responsibility for the miscalculations amidst a broader industry downturn.

opendoor Opendoor Cuts 18% of Staff Amid Broad Housing Market Downturn Real estate tech company Opendoor lays off nearly a fifth of its workforce as the housing market cools rapidly. The cutbacks reflect a wider trend of downsizing across the property technology sector.
opendoor Opendoor Cuts 18% of Workforce Amid Historic Real Estate Slump Opendoor lays off 550 employees as skyrocketing mortgage rates and inflation severely reduce housing demand. The proptech firm's stock plummets from previous highs as it navigates what its CEO calls the toughest market in 40 years.

seagate Seagate Eliminates 3,000 Jobs Amid Slowing Tech Demand Seagate Technology is cutting 3,000 jobs as global economic uncertainties and inventory corrections reduce demand for computer hard drives. The company also faces US allegations of illegally selling drives to sanctioned Chinese telecom giant Huawei.

arrival EV Maker Arrival Shifts Focus to US Market Amid New Job Cuts Commercial EV startup Arrival is restructuring for the second time in six months, pivoting away from the UK to focus on the US market. The move brings significant global job cuts as the company aims to stretch its $330 million cash runway.
